Weirdest Tourist Attraction in Illinois

Big Things Small Town in Casey, Illinois is a small town that features a few of the world's largest items. Buzzfeed says:

Casey may be a small town, but it's home to 12 big world records, including the world's largest rocking chair, pitchfork, mailbox, and wind chime.

Weirdest Tourist Attraction in Indiana

Indiana is also home to a thing that is the largest in the world...the World's Largest Ball of Paint in Alexandria. Buzzfeed says:

What started as a baseball dipped into paint has become, well, <i>this.</i> Visitors can even take a stab at painting a new layer.

Weirdest Tourist Attraction in Kentucky

Okay, I don't find this one weird at all. In fact, I think this is pretty cool. Cave City, Kentucky is home to Dinosaur World. Here, you can roam the park filled with hundreds of life-sized dinosaurs in a natural setting. Buzzfeed makes a good point by saying:

It's not <i>quite</i> as high tech as Jurassic Park, but maybe that's for the best.
